About WiseTech Global
WiseTech Global Limited engages in the development and provision of software solutions to the logistics execution industry in the Americas, the Asia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. It develops, sells, and implements software solutions that enable and empower logistics service providers to facilitate the movement and storage of goods and information. Financial Performance
In fiscal year 2025, WiseTech Global's revenue was $778.70 million, an increase of 13.89% compared to the previous year's $683.70 million. Earnings were $200.70 million, an increase of 16.48%.

WiseTech Global Transcript: Investor Day 2025
The event detailed a major transformation with the launch of CargoWise Value Packs, a new commercial model simplifying pricing and bundling advanced features, and the integration of E2open to expand the addressable market. AI-driven automation and container optimization are set to drive significant productivity gains and revenue growth, with 95% of customers already transitioned to the new model.

WiseTech Global Transcript: AGM 2025
The AGM highlighted strong financial growth, a 24% dividend increase, and successful integration of e2open. Board renewal and succession planning were emphasized, with new directors and a new CEO appointed. Shareholders raised concerns on governance, remuneration, and ongoing regulatory investigations.
